Cultivating Human Resources through Product Development
AKITAKENHAKKO KOGYO cooperated in the product development of "Mitcheri Sour no Moto," an alcoholic beverage invented by the students of Akita Prefectural Yuzawa Shohoku High School. The product is a liqueur made from mitcheri (locally grown cherries that are dried using geothermal heat). The product was commercialized in October 2021 after a joint product development effort with the school’s students. We also offer hands-on experience in labeling and packaging bottles and assisting with sales at local retailers.

Donating and Prioritizing the Supply of Alcohol
To help fight COVID-19, we donated alcohol to help with sterilization. In 2020, we donated approximately 6,000 liters of alcohol for this purpose to five cities and towns in Hokkaido and Shizuoka Prefecture, where our offices are located.
That same year, we supplied specific fermentative alcohol in response to the Ministry of Health, Labour and Welfare’s request for cooperation in the "Priority Scheme for the Stable Supply of Ethanol for Hand Sanitizer." After adjusting the alcohol content, the ministry supplied this alcohol to medical institutions and used it as ethanol for disinfection.

Providing Drinking Water
GODO SHUSEI’s Shimizu Factory collaborated with Suzuyo & Co., Ltd. to provide drinking water in Shimizu-ku, Shizuoka, which experienced a long-term water outage due to Typhoon No. 15, which struck in September 2022.
